Enhancing Sensitivity of Detection of Immune Responses to Mycobacterium leprae Peptides in Whole-Blood Assays

Although worldwide leprosy prevalence has been reduced considerably following multidrug therapy, new case detection rates remain relatively stable, suggesting that transmission of infection still continues.
